Kariakoo Derby Final: Yanga and Simba Set for Muungano Cup Showdown

The long-awaited day for football fans in Tanzania has finally arrived. It’s the Muungano Cup final between Yanga and Simba, set to take place at the New Amaan Complex in Zanzibar.

This is the Kariakoo Derby—marking the third meeting between the two rivals in the 2025/26 season.

The two sides first met on September 16, 2025, in the Community Shield, where Pacome Zouzoua scored the only goal to secure the trophy for Yanga.

They faced off again on March 1, 2026, in a Mainland Premier League match at the same venue, which ended in a goalless draw.

Now, they meet once more at the New Amaan Complex in a decisive clash where a winner must be determined—either within 90 minutes or through a penalty shootout.

Yanga are the defending champions of the Muungano Cup, having won the title last season after defeating JKU in the final.

It presents another opportunity for Yanga to retain the trophy and bring it back to Jangwani for a second consecutive season.

However, it will not be an easy match against their rivals Simba, who have gone seven consecutive matches without a win against Yanga.

Yanga head into this match in better form compared to their last meeting in March.

The presence of attacking midfielder Pacome Zouzoua is a major boost for Yanga, as he missed the previous encounter due to a shoulder injury.

Pacome has scored two goals in his last two matches against Simba and has three goals overall in derby encounters.

He has proven to be a decisive player in past derbies and could once again influence the outcome of today’s match.

Tactically, Yanga have also improved. The arrival of assistant coach Abdulhamid Moalin has brought a shift in playing style, with the team now adopting a faster, more attacking approach compared to the start of the season.

Yanga fans are expecting a more offensive display today, unlike the previous match where the team spent long periods defending.

Overall, the game is expected to feature attacking football from both sides, with defensive discipline and clinical finishing likely to determine the final result.
